Guidelines when installing the ducting

WARNING
Do NOT install operating ignition sources (example: open
flames, an operating gas appliance or an operating electric
heater) in the duct work.
CAUTION
▪ Make sure the installation of the duct does NOT exceed
the setting range of the external static pressure for the
unit. Refer to the technical datasheet of your model for
the setting range.
▪ Make sure to install the canvas duct so vibrations are
NOT transmitted to the duct or ceiling. Use a sound-
absorbing material (insulation material) for the lining of
the duct and apply vibration insulation rubber to the
hanging bolts.
▪ When welding, make sure NOT to spatter onto the
drain pan or the air filter.
▪ If the metal duct passes through a metal lath, wire lath
or metal plate of the wooden structure, separate the
duct and wall electrically.
▪ Install the outlet grille in a position where the airflow will
not come into direct contact with people.
▪ Do NOT use booster fans in the duct. Use the function
to adjust the fan rate setting automatically (see
"16 Configuration" [ 4  18]).
The ducting is to be field supplied.

1 Remove the air outlet flange from the transportation case cover.
2 Move and attach the air outlet flange to the air outlet side.
3 Fix the air outlet flange with the 34 screws for duct flanges
(accessory).
4 Fix the air inlet flange using the remaining 15 screws for duct
flanges (accessory).
5 Connect the canvas duct to the inside of the flange on both
sides.
6 Connect the duct to the canvas duct on both sides.
7 Wind aluminium tape around the flanges and duct connections.
Make sure there are no air leaks at any other connection.

8 Insulate the ducts to prevent condensation from forming. Use
glass wool or polyethylene foam 25 mm thick.

▪ Filter. Be sure to attach an air filter inside the air passage on the
air inlet side. Use an air filter with dust collecting efficiency ≥50%
(gravimetric method). The included filter is not used when the
intake duct is attached.
12.2.3
Guidelines when installing the drain
piping
Make sure condensation water can be evacuated properly. This
involves:
▪ General guidelines
▪ Connecting the drain piping to the indoor unit
▪ Checking for water leaks
General guidelines
▪ Pipe length. Keep drain piping as short as possible.
▪ Pipe size. Keep the pipe size equal to or greater than that of the
connecting pipe (vinyl pipe of 25  mm nominal diameter and
32 mm outer diameter).
▪ Slope. Make sure the drain piping slopes down (at least 1/100) to
prevent air from being trapped in the piping. Use hanging bars as
shown.

▪ Condensation. Take measures against condensation. Insulate
the complete drain piping in the building.
▪ Combining drain pipes. It is possible to combine drain pipes.
Use drain pipes and T-joints with the correct gauge for the
operating capacity of the units.
